Located at 16 Burnham Road in Norfolk, The Little Barn is an award-winning bijou barn conversion nestled in the charming village of Ringstead. Accommodating up to four guests, this delightful vacation home features two bedrooms and is ideally situated just two miles from the beach, making it a perfect retreat for families and friends. Guests can enjoy a leisurely ten-minute walk to a nearby gastro pub, enhancing the experience of this romantic hideaway. The barn's design emphasizes quality and clever use of space, ensuring a comfortable stay in the picturesque North West Norfolk region.
Converted in 2015, The Little Barn boasts a striking open-plan vaulted living area that creates a bright and airy atmosphere, while still feeling cozy. The ground floor includes a master bedroom with direct access to a south-facing courtyard garden and an en-suite bathroom equipped with both a bath and a separate shower cubicle. The second bedroom, located on the first floor, features a galley-style layout with four full-size cabin beds. While the barn has one en-suite bathroom, there is an additional cloakroom on the ground floor, making it functional for small groups who are comfortable sharing facilities.
Although The Little Barn is not suitable for more than four adults, it offers ample space for couples or families willing to share. The village of Ringstead is known for its friendly atmosphere and good local amenities, providing easy access to the stunning coastal and rural landscapes of Norfolk. Visitors can indulge in a variety of outdoor activities, including walking, cycling, and birdwatching, all of which are readily available in the surrounding area.
Guests will find the barn well-equipped for their stay, featuring a kitchenette with essential appliances such as an electric cooker, microwave, and dishwasher. The living area includes comfortable seating, a dining table, and entertainment options like a television with Freeview, Netflix access, and a DVD player. Outside, the enclosed courtyard garden is perfect for relaxation and socializing, complete with seating and a barbecue. Parking is available for up to two cars on the shared driveway, ensuring convenience for those looking to explore local attractions like Hunstanton Golf Club and the Norfolk Coast Path.
